Superno Academy is a multi-pov dark fae romantasy series following a war against unruly royals, various monsters, Gods, time itself, and the Queen of the Demon Realm and its inhabitants. It has a lot of shifters, Greek mythology, fae lore, Norse mythology, and various supernatural things in general.

It follows three sisters, and each has their own romance that varies in speed/style due to the nature of the FMCs.
One has a why choose romance with MM, two has an MF romance, and three has FF romances.
